The backpacks were presented by Gerry Boyle, race director of Ironman Maryland. The Ironman Maryland Competition is an annual triathlon race in Cambridge, guiding athletes through Dorchester County and Blackwater National Wildlife Refuge.
“We are glad to be able to support Dorchester County’s schools and involve the students in Ironman Maryland in as many ways as possible,” Boyle said.
The backpacks are a gift to the more than 300 students who volunteered to help with the event. They will be distributed to individual schools throughout Dorchester County.
“It is this kind of community support that makes Ironman Maryland a popular race for triathletes,” Boyle said.
